2014 Lamborghini Aventador Check Engine Light Flashing
A flashing check engine light usually indicates a severe condition such as an active engine misfire that can rapidly damage the catalytic converter and lead to costly repairs. When the light is flashing, reduce load on the engine, avoid high RPMs, and stop driving as soon as it is safe — continued operation risks component failure and can convert a minor repair into an expensive replacement. 2014 Lamborghini Aventador Check Engine Light Reset
Resetting the check engine light via an OBD-II clear command is simple, but it only masks the symptom without repairing the cause. A cleared light can return and may erase valuable diagnostic freeze-frame data that helps technicians pinpoint intermittent faults. 2014 Lamborghini Aventador Check Engine Light Codes
Typical codes for this vehicle include misfire codes (P0300–P0306), fuel trim and air/fuel mixture codes (P0171/P0174), oxygen sensor or catalytic efficiency (P0130–P0167, P0420), and thermostat or cooling (P0128). Left unfixed, misfires can ruin catalytic converters ($2,000–$6,000+ for replacement), oxygen sensor faults reduce fuel economy and emissions, and fuel system issues accelerate wear on injectors and pumps.
